General Information

Title: Sperent in te omnes
Composer: Costanzo Porta
Lyricist:

Number of voices: 5vv   Voicing: SAAAT

Genre: SacredMotet

Language: Latin
Instruments: A cappella

Original text and translations

Latin.png Latin text

Sperent in te omnes, qui noverunt nomen tuum, Domine.
Quoniam non derelinquis quærentes te.
Psallite Domino, qui habitat in Sion,
quoniam non est oblitus orationem pauperum.
